Игры на Python: открой для себя мир кодинга!

d0b8d0b3d180d18b d0bdd0b0 python d0bed182d0bad180d0bed0b9 d0b4d0bbd18f d181d0b5d0b1d18f d0bcd0b8d180 d0bad0bed0b4d0b8d0bdd0b3d0b0

Игры на Python - это увлекательный способ познакомиться с миром программирования. С помощью этого языка можно создавать не только полезные утилиты, но и интересные игры. В этой статье мы рассмотрим возможности Python в области игрового开发мента и покажем, как можно создать свою собственную игру с нуля. Это будет интересно как начинающим, так и опытным программистам, желающим расширить свои знания и навыки в этой области. Попробуйте самим и откройте для себя мир кодинга и игр на Python. Это будет захватывающее приключение.

Индекс

Игры на Python: открой для себя мир кодинга!

Игры на Python - это увлекательный способ познакомиться с миром программирования и повысить свои навыки в области кодирования. Python - это один из наиболее популярных языков программирования, легко усваиваемый и понятный даже для начинающих. С помощью Python можно создавать игры, приложения и другие программы, которые могут быть использованы в различных областях жизни.

Основы программирования на Python

Чтобы начала играть в игры на Python, необходимо иметь представление об основах программирования на этом языке. Для этого необходимо изучить такие концепции, как переменные, типы данных, управляющие конструкции и функции. Кроме того, необходимо познакомиться с библиотеками и модулями, которые могут быть использованы для создания игр и других программ. Некоторые из наиболее важных библиотек для создания игр на Python включают:

  1. Pygame - библиотека для создания игр с использованием Python
  2. Pyglet - библиотека для создания игр и других мультимедийных программ
  3. PyOpenGL - библиотека для создания 3D-игр и других программ с использованием OpenGL

Создание игр на Python

Создание игр на Python может быть увлекательным и творческим процессом. С помощью Python можно создавать игры различных жанров, от простых аркадных игр до сложных стратегий и ролевых игр. Для создания игры необходимо иметь идею, спроектировать игровой процесс и создать код, который будет реализовывать игру. Некоторые из наиболее популярных жанров игр, которые можно создать на Python, включают:

  1. Аркадные игры - игры, в которых необходимо выполнить определенное задание или набрать очки
  2. Стратегии и ролевые игры - игры, в которых необходимо управлять ресурсами, принимать решения и выполнять задания
  3. Приключенческие игры - игры, в которых необходимо решать задачи и выполнить определенное задание

Преимущества игр на Python

Игры на Python имеют несколько преимуществ, которые делают их привлекательными для программистов и игроков. Некоторые из наиболее значимых преимуществ включают:

  1. Улучшение навыков программирования - игры на Python могут помочь улучшить навыки программирования и научиться новым концепциям
  2. Развитие творческих способностей - игры на Python могут помочь развить творческие способности и научиться создавать новые и интересные игры
  3. Возможность создать что-то новое - игры на Python могут дать возможность создать что-то новое и уникальное, что может быть использовано в различных областях жизни

Ресурсы для изучения игр на Python

Для изучения игр на Python существует много ресурсов, которые могут помочь начать. Некоторые из наиболее популярных ресурсов включают:

  1. Официальная документация Python - документация, в которой описаны все возможности и функции Python
  2. Курсы и уроки по Python - курсы и уроки, в которых можно научиться программировать на Python
  3. Сообщества и форумы - сообщества и форумы, в которых можно общаться с другими программистами и игроками

Проблемы и сложности в играх на Python

Игры на Python могут иметь некоторые проблемы и сложности, которые необходимо учитывать. Некоторые из наиболее значимых проблем включают:

  1. Сложность кода - код игр на Python может быть сложным и трудным для понимания
  2. Отсутствие документации - отсутствие документации может затруднить изучение и использование некоторых библиотек и модулей
  3. Проблемы с производительностью - игры на Python могут иметь проблемы с производительностью, особенно если они требуют больших ресурсов

Часто задаваемые вопросы

В чем заключается основная идея игр на Python?

Игры на Python открывают для себя мир кодинга, позволяя создавать свои собственные игры и проекты. С помощью Python можно создавать различные типы игр, от простых текстовых приключений до сложных графических игр. Библиотеки и фреймворки, такие как Pygame и PyQt, предоставляют инструменты и ресурсы для создания игр. Игры на Python могут быть использованы для обучения и развлечения, а также для разработки навыков программирования.

Какие библиотеки и фреймворки используются для создания игр на Python?

Для создания игр на Python используются различные библиотеки и фреймворки, такие как Pygame, PyQt и Pyglet. Эти библиотеки предоставляют инструменты и ресурсы для создания игр, включая графику, звук и ввод. Pygame является одной из самых популярных библиотек для создания игр на Python, она предоставляет простой и интуитивный интерфейс для создания игр. PyQt и Pyglet также являются популярными библиотеками, они предоставляют богатый и функциональный интерфейс для создания игр.

Могу ли я создать игру на Python без опыта программирования?

Да, можно создать игру на Python без опыта программирования. Python является легким в изучении языком, и есть много ресурсов и туториалов, которые могут помочь начинающим программистам. Библиотеки и фреймворки, такие как Pygame и PyQt, предоставляют простой и интуитивный интерфейс для создания игр. Онлайн-курсы и видео-уроки также могут помочь начинающим программистам в学习е Python и создании игр. Сообщества программистов и форумы также могут предоставить поддержку и помощь в создании игр.

Какие перспективы и возможности открываются после изучения игр на Python?

Изучение игр на Python открывает перспективы и возможности в области программирования и разработки. Знания и навыки, полученные при создании игр на Python, могут быть использованы для создания других проектов и приложений. Опыт работы с библиотękями и фреймворками может быть полезен в разработке других проектов. Возможности трудоустройства также открываются, поскольку знания и навыки программирования на Python являются востребованными на рынке труда. Участие в сообществах программистов и форумах также может предоставить поддержку и помощь в развитии карьеры.

Если вы хотите узнать о других статьях, похожих на Игры на Python: открой для себя мир кодинга!, вы можете посетить категорию Основы Python.

Похожие посты